Recognizing E-Bike Category



When it comes to browsing the world of e-bike laws and policies, a vital beginning point is understanding the classification system that categorizes these electric bicycles. E-bikes are typically identified right into 3 major groups: Class 1, Course 2, and Course 3.

Class 1 e-bikes are pedal-assist only, suggesting they supply assistance while the rider is pedaling and have a maximum speed of 20 mph. These bikes are allowed locations where standard bikes are allowed.

Course 2 e-bikes are furnished with a throttle that can thrust the bike without pedaling. They additionally have a maximum speed of 20 mph and are suitable for riders who may require support without pedaling continuously.
